I have taken this overland trip to Lhasa but also returned back to Kathmandu 3 days later by road.
There was some other travellers on the tour who where conituning into China, so I don't think you will have a problem but you must get a proper tourist Visa for China.
When I did the trip the travel Agency in Kathmandu sorted out the Visa's for everyone for those who where returning back to Kathmandu because the Visa was on a piece of A4 paper and nothing goes into the passport, I was really disapointed at that but I still got to see Lhasa.
The reason is quite simple the Chinese do not like foreigners travelling from Nepal to see Tibet and return back again and not go onto China proper.
But if you are going onto see the rest of China you must get a proper Visa in your Passport like other countries do. Again the travel agency who will book your tour should be able get you a proper visa for China.
You shouldn't have any problems in Kathmandu with the Travel Agency most are realiable.
